Butocrysa
Butocrysa is the scientific name of a group -also called lamiines or flat-faced longhorned beetles-
Butocrysa Thomson, 1868
J. Thomson is the author of the original taxon.
The type species is Amphionycha insignis Lucas, 1859.
Butocrysa Thomson, 1868 is the full name of the group-genus in the taxonomic classification system.
Butocrysa has 1 species. This genus is ranked in the tribe Hemilophini.
